Conversion Formula for Kilopond to Centinewton
The formula of conversion of Kilopond to Centinewton is very simple. To convert Kilopond to Centinewton, we can use this simple formula:
1 Kilopond = 980.665 Centinewton
1 Centinewton = 0.0010197162 Kilopond
One Kilopond is equal to 980.665 Centinewton. So, we need to multiply the number of Kilopond by 980.665 to get the no of Centinewton. This formula helps when we need to change the measurements from Kilopond to Centinewton

Details for Kilopond (Gravitational Metric Unit)
Introduction : A kilopond is the force exerted by a mass of one kilogram under Earth’s gravity, and is numerically equal to a kilogram-force (approximately 9.80665 N). It’s a legacy unit once widely used in Europe.
History & Origin : The term “kilopond” was commonly used across European industries in the early 20th century before the widespread acceptance of SI units. It was defined as the force of standard gravity on a one-kilogram mass.
Current Use : Though largely obsolete, kiloponds still appear in older engineering textbooks, pressure gauge scales, and specifications for small engines and hydraulic systems where gravitational force is intuitively referenced.
Details for Centinewton (Hundredth of a Newton)
Introduction : A centinewton equals one-hundredth of a newton (0.01 N), and is ideal for quantifying extremely small forces. It is particularly useful in situations where precision at the lower end of the force scale is essential.
History & Origin : The centinewton, like other SI submultiples, was introduced to allow scientists and engineers to work within a consistent decimal system. It gained modest use in sensitive instrumentation, such as low-range force gauges and physics education kits.
Current Use : Centinewtons are often used in textile tension testing, ergonomic assessments, and small-scale mechanical measurements. They are especially useful in force sensors for measuring friction or static loads in delicate components.

What is the Symbol of kilopond and centinewton?
The symbol for kilopond is 'kp', and for centinewtons, it is 'cN'. These symbols are used to denote force in everyday and technical measurements.
